feat(infrastructure): implement Gear repository and HTTP client
Add SQL repository and HTTP client implementations for Gear entity. SQL Repository (infrastructure/repositories/gear.rs): - SqlGearRepository with CRUD operations - order_clause() for sorting: Make/Model (case-insensitive), Category, CreatedAt - build_where_clause() for category filtering - to_domain() converts GearRecord to domain Gear with category parsing - Uses push_update_field! macro for partial updates - Proper error handling with RepositoryError types HTTP Client (infrastructure/client/gear.rs): - GearClient for CLI access to API endpoints - Methods: create(), list(), get(), update(), delete() - Supports optional category filter in list() - Error context with anyhow for user-friendly messages Module Registration: - Register gear module in infrastructure/repositories/mod.rs - Register gear module and gear() method in infrastructure/client/mod.rs Follows the exact patterns from BagRepository and BagsClient.
